Why Moisture Source Identification Services in Fort Collins Matters
Imagine treating a leaky pipe by simply wiping up the water without fixing the pipe itself. The problem persists, and the damage continues. Similarly, addressing mold without identifying the moisture source is a temporary fix that ultimately fails to solve the problem.
Here’s why identifying the source is essential:
- Effective Mold Remediation: By tackling the root cause of mold growth, you ensure that remediation efforts are targeted and effective, preventing mold from returning.
- Health Protection: Mold can have detrimental effects on your health, triggering allergies, respiratory issues, and other complications, especially in individuals with sensitivities.
- Preventing Structural Damage: Prolonged moisture exposure can weaken your home’s structural integrity, causing wood rot, foundation damage, and compromised insulation.
- Cost Savings: Addressing moisture issues early prevents them from escalating into larger, more expensive problems requiring extensive repairs.
Common Hiding Spots: Where to Look for Moisture Sources
Often, the source of moisture is not immediately apparent. It requires careful inspection and an understanding of common problem areas. Here are some prime suspects to investigate:
1. Plumbing: Leaking pipes, dripping faucets, faulty appliance connections, and slow leaks under sinks are common culprits behind hidden moisture problems.
2. Roof: A damaged or aging roof, missing shingles, or improperly sealed flashing can allow rainwater to seep into your attic, walls, and ceilings.
3. Ventilation: Inadequate ventilation in areas like bathrooms, kitchens, and basements allows humidity to build up, creating a perfect environment for mold to thrive.
4. Exterior Drainage: Improperly graded lawns, clogged gutters, and downspouts that don’t direct water away from your foundation can lead to basement moisture and foundation problems.
5. Condensation: Warm, humid air coming into contact with cold surfaces like windows, walls, and pipes can lead to condensation, providing moisture for mold growth.
6. Appliances: Washing machines, dishwashers, and refrigerators with leaky hoses, faulty seals, or drainage issues can introduce significant moisture into your home.
7. Hidden Leaks: Past leaks, floods, or spills, even if seemingly resolved, can leave lingering moisture within walls, under floors, or above ceilings, creating hidden mold havens.
